Regular Season Round 11: Bnot Hertzeliya - ASA Jerusalem 70-63
Date: December 31, 2015
There was no surprise when 5th ranked ASA Jerusalem (5-6) was defeated on the road by second ranked Bnot Hertzeliya (8-3) 70-63 on Thursday. It was a great evening for the former international forward Liad Suez-Karni (187-81, college: Villanova) who led her team to a victory scoring 25 points, 6 rebounds and 4 assists. American guard Jasmine Thomas (175-89, college: Duke) helped adding 13 points, 12 rebounds and 9 assists. Four Bnot Hertzeliya players scored in double figures. American center Shamela Hampton (191-87, college: UNLV) responded with a double-double by scoring 22 points and 12 rebounds and the other American import forward Asia Taylor (185-91, college: Louisville, agency: LBM Management) produced a double-double by scoring 17 points and 14 rebounds. Bnot Hertzeliya maintains second place with 8-3 record having just two points less than leader Maccabi R.Hen, which they share with Ramat Hasharon. Loser ASA Jerusalem keeps the fifth position with six games lost. Bnot Hertzeliya will meet league's leader Maccabi Ramat Hen on the road in the next round and it will be for sure the game of the week. ASA Jerusalem will play against Ramat Hasharon (#3) and it may be a tough game between close rivals.
